Easy Parmesan Crusted Tilapia

Elevate your weeknight dinners with this Easy Parmesan Crusted Tilapia recipe—an irresistible and healthy meal ready in just 25 minutes! Featuring tender tilapia fillets coated in a golden crust of Parmesan cheese, crunchy breadcrumbs, and zesty seasonings like garlic powder and paprika, this dish strikes the perfect balance of flavor and texture. With a quick oven bake instead of frying, it's a lighter option that doesn’t skimp on crispiness, especially with a drizzle of olive oil for extra crunch. Serve these beautifully baked fillets with fresh lemon wedges for an added burst of brightness. Prep Time:10 mins
Cook Time:15 mins
Total Time:25 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 4 pieces Tilapia fillets
  • 1 cup Parmesan cheese, grated
  • 1 cup Breadcrumbs, plain or panko
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on Paprika
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 2 pieces Eggs, large
  • 2 tablespoons Olive oil
  • 4 pieces Fresh lemon wedges

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or lightly grease it with olive oil.

Step 2

Pat tilapia fillets dry with a paper towel to remove excess moisture.

Step 3

In a shallow bowl, combine the grated Parmesan cheese, breadcrumbs,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and black pepper. Mix well.

Step 4

In another shallow bowl, beat the eggs until smooth.

Step 5

Dip one tilapia fillet into the beaten eggs, ensuring it is fully coated on both sides.

Step 6

Press the fillet into the Parmesan-breadcrumb mixture, coating it evenly and pressing gently to adhere the breading. Repeat with the remaining fillets.

Step 7

Place the coated fillets onto the prepared baking sheet in a single layer.

Step 8

Drizzle the olive oil evenly over the top of the fillets to enhance crispiness.

Step 9

Bake in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es or until the fish is golden brown and flakes easily with a fork.

Step 10

Remove the fillets from the oven and serve immediately with fresh lemon wedges on the side.
